Hella 80/100 watt headlight impressions...

Wow! I installed the Sucro Relay and Hella 80/100 bulbs in my H4's. I was thinking of going with the 100/130 Narva bulbs, but have decided there is no need. The 80 watt low beams give great illumination. Much better "light spread" and even better lateral lighting. The high beams are amazing. No need to go for the 130's unless you are working for SETI and want to flash the Martians.

If you travel mountain roads at night, this upgrade could help you avoid some unpleasant wildlife encounters. Takes 1/2 hour if you're competent. Took me 1 1/2hours.

I agree...exactly what I did! I was really suprised at how much the relays helped...even 55/65s were awesome, but the 80/100s are killer. Pays to take your time and doublecheck everything so as not to fry things. Also, in non-SC cars, the Sucro instructions need a bit of translation to account for different fuse locations.
